Position Overview:

As part of the talented Navico Group Operations Engineering team, you will be responsible to coordinate and/or execute complex Engineering Projects based on in-depth knowledge within their area of engineering specialization. Provides direction, supervision, and technical support to the Test Engineering group. Defines work priorities and coordinates with various departments at the Ensenada plant to implement testing solutions across different assembly processes. Leads projects, manages resources and Test Engineering personnel, and makes decisions using independent judgment.

Essential Functions:

Test Engineering & Equipment Management

  • Develop, document, and maintain operating procedures, repair logs, and technical documentation for test equipment and fixtures. (Critical)
  • Provide technical guidance and support for the repair and maintenance of test equipment and fixtures. (Critical)
  • Design, specify, and support the development of fixtures and production test equipment for manual and automated processes. (Critical)
  • Generate and manage engineering documentation, including CRs, DRDs, test specifications, DFTs, and work orders.
  • Specify and source electronic and mechanical components for test equipment.
  • Maintain and update schematics and drawings using sound engineering judgment.

Process Optimization & Continuous Improvement

  • Partner with Process Engineering to ensure optimal production performance and product quality.
  • Review and validate equipment, fixtures, and test methods to ensure effectiveness and reliability.
  • Promote a culture of continuous improvement focused on quality, efficiency, and cost reduction.
  • Identify and lead initiatives to improve yield, reduce test cycle time, and lower overall costs.
  • Evaluate and implement new testing technologies.

Product Development & Cross-Functional Collaboration

  • Collaborate with Design Engineering on hardware and software development to optimize assembly and testing processes.
  • Support New Product Introduction (NPI) efforts, ensuring readiness of test systems and adherence to timelines.
  • Define and develop manufacturing test plans and perform Design for Test (DFT) analysis.
  • Provide technical support to Test Engineering team members on assigned projects.

Operational Execution & Problem Solving

  • Spend time on the production floor to monitor and support test equipment and fixture performance.
  • Independently troubleshoot and resolve complex engineering issues using methodologies such as 8D, PDCA, Six Sigma, and 5 Whys.
  • Document root cause analysis, corrective actions, and outcomes.
  • Provide timely and accurate progress updates to leadership.

Leadership & Team Management

  • Lead technical resources, prioritizing daily activities and ensuring timely execution.
  • Develop Test Engineers and/or Technicians, fostering engagement and accountability.
  • Lead cost reduction and First Pass Yield (FPY) improvement initiatives.

Safety, Quality & Compliance

  • Comply with all company safety, health, and environmental standards; proactively identify and address unsafe conditions.
  • Follow all applicable Quality Management System (QMS) requirements related to assigned work.
  • Maintain a clean, organized, and safe working environment.

Required Qualifications:

  • Bachelor’s degree in Electronic Engineering or a related field.
  • 10+ years of experience in Test Engineering roles within a manufacturing environment.
  • Demonstrated experience with electronic device assembly processes.
  • Strong knowledge of RF/microwave signals and electronics, including RADAR applications.
  • Advanced proficiency in LabVIEW and TestStand.
  • Strong analytical and problem-solving skills, with proficiency in relevant analytical tools and methodologies.
  • Proven experience in project management, with the ability to deliver results across cross-functional teams.
  • High level of English proficiency (written and verbal).

About Navico Group:

Navico Group is a stand-alone division of Brunswick, the world’s largest recreational marine business.

Navico Group is the global leader in technology, systems and solutions for a variety of industries, from Marine & RV to Specialty Vehicles and beyond. Our broad portfolio consists of the industry's leading brands in Power Systems, Digital Systems, Fishing Systems, and Performance Components including Ancor, Attwood, B&G, BEP, Blue Sea Systems, C-MAP, CZone, Garelick, Lenco, Lowrance, Marinco, MotorGuide, Mastervolt, ProMariner, RELiON, Simrad and Whale.
